IP查询
查询
你查询的IP:[119.128.7.115] 地理位置:中国–广东–东莞
最新查询
116.194.191.59
122.8.230.198
123.98.155.254
222.125.50.24
125.62.178.223
120.94.235.115
123.178.245.78
116.4.124.97
116.207.77.140
119.128.7.115
203.142.219.191
116.254.128.205
121.204.84.64
117.8.208.197
116.196.227.212
120.94.85.236
117.59.144.181
203.100.192.209
124.128.148.148
123.206.84.139
122.112.235.97
118.184.131.230
118.248.38.32
119.4.145.182
117.75.182.16
124.72.224.105
117.74.128.225
124.196.99.70
124.20.185.155
120.72.128.252
122.90.128.45